India today expressed gratitude and appreciation to Afghan authorities for the professionalism and alacrity with which they acted against the abductors of a local employee of the Indian consulate in Jalalabad.A day after Afghan national Abdol Wadud escaped following three days of captivity, the Ministry of External Affairs said all possible assistance will be rendered to him by the Consulate General of India.He is being treated for injuries he sustained when the kidnappers fired at him.A MEA statement said that an investigation is currently going on and the details of the abduction, search and rescue operation and identity or the motive of the abduction are not available.Wadud was abducted by a group of armed men in Jalalabad after being shot and injured on Saturday, and he escaped on Monday night.
